We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
1 parent a987bd8 commit 65ea360Copy full SHA for 65ea360
pcsx2/VU0microInterp.cpp
@@ -279,22 +279,22 @@ void InterpVU0::Execute(u32 cycles)
279
switch (std::min(static_cast<int>(EmuConfig.Speedhacks.EECycleRate), static_cast<int>(cycle_change)))
280
{
281
case -3: // 50%
282
- cycle_change *= 2.0f;
+ cycle_change /= 3.0f;
283
break;
284
case -2: // 60%
285
- cycle_change *= 1.6666667f;
+ cycle_change /= 1.8f;
286
287
case -1: // 75%
288
- cycle_change *= 1.3333333f;
+ cycle_change /= 1.3f;
289
290
case 1: // 130%
291
- cycle_change /= 1.3f;
+ cycle_change *= 1.3333333f;
292
293
case 2: // 180%
294
- cycle_change /= 1.8f;
+ cycle_change *= 2.0f;
295
296
case 3: // 300%
297
- cycle_change /= 3.0f;
+ cycle_change *= 5.0f;
298
299
default:
300
0 commit comments